Arbuckle is a CDP located in Colusa County, California. Arbuckle has a 2025 population of 3,083. Arbuckle is currently growing at a rate of 0.13% annually but its population has decreased by -8.46%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 3,368 in 2020.

The average household income in Arbuckle is $96,041 with a poverty rate of 3.8%.The median age in Arbuckle is 32.1 years: 29.8 years for males, and 33.6 years for females.

Demographics

The racial composition of Arbuckle includes 48.27% White, 28.33% other race, and smaller percentages for Native American, Asian and multiracial populations.

Economics and Income Statistics

Arbuckle's average per capita income is $46,848. Household income levels show a median of $83,677. The poverty rate stands at 3.8%.

Families: A family includes the owner or renter of the home along with everyone related to them - whether through birth, marriage, or adoption. This includes relatives like spouses, children, parents, siblings, grandparents, and any other family members.
Households: A household includes all the people who occupy a housing unit (such as a house or apartment) as their usual place of residence.
Non Families: A nonfamily household is either someone living alone or when the owner/renter lives with people they aren't related to, like roommates.
